Why Storm Water Management?

The GA Department of Natural Resources (DNR) and Alabama Department of Environmental Management (ADEM) SPDES [State Pollutant Discharge Elimination System] General Permit for Storm Water Discharges from Construction Activity includes provisions for developing a Storm Water Pollution Prevention Plan (SWPPP).

A SWPPP must be developed for construction sites with land disturbances of one or more acres. The purpose of the SWPPP is to maximize the potential benefits of pollution prevention and sediment and erosion control measures.
